1. Choose Ready Meals with Variety
Opt for meals that incorporate a diverse array of ingredients. A colorful and varied diet ensures you receive a broad spectrum of nutrients, including v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ants, all vital for overall health. For instance, our Thai Green Curry combines edamame, brown rice, red capsicum, green beans, carrot, kale, and a blend of herbs and spices, offering a rich mix of flavours and nutrients.

Especially for those with dietary needs, incorporating diversity within the dietary boundaries can enhance the enjoyment of meals and prevent dietary monotony. When meals are varied, it’s can make it easier to stick to healthy eating habits, as the flavours and textures keep things interesting. This approach also contributes to a positive relationship with food, making mealtime a more enjoyable experience that nourishes both the body and mind.
2. Incorporate Vegetarian or Vegan Options
Including plant-based meals can boost your intake of fibre, vitamins, and minerals while reducing saturated fat and cholesterol. This dietary shift may lower the risk of chronic diseases such as heart disease, diabetes, and certain cancers. Additionally, plant-based diets support digestive health and contribute to environmental sustainability by reducing your carbon footprint.

3. Select Appropriate Portion Sizes
Be mindful of portion sizes to align with your hunger cues and nutritional needs. Consuming portions that are too small may leave you unsatisfied, potentially leading to unhealthy snacking. Conversely, overly large portions can result in overeating. Our meals are designed to provide satisfying portions that promote satiety and support a balanced diet.
4. Opt for Healthier Alternatives to Takeout
Ready meals can be a healthier alternative to traditional takeout, often lower in unhealthy fats, sugars, and sodium.
